A global leadership education organization is seeking professionals for a remote role that offers flexible scheduling and a structured pathway to personal and leadership development. The role supports individuals in achieving personal growth through mentorship and training in digital business systems.
Ideal candidates are self-motivated, strong communicators passionate about leadership, and wish to establish a new income stream aligned with their values. This position is suitable for those looking to transition into a purpose-driven career.
